5. Tenacity Triumphs
The Old Testament Prophet Daniel served in the royal court of four consecutive Babylonian kings. He famously survived a night in a lion’s den. However, Daniel’s legacy is a wise and righteous God-fearing exile living in a polytheistic foreign culture.
Neither the kings nor the culture changed Daniel’s tenacious relationship with God. He was as virtuous at the end as when first pressed into servitude. His consistent life of unwavering faith and prayer awarded him God’s promotion, provision, and protection.
Let’s be people of God who remain faithful and continually pray no matter who governs the nation.
